how is the peripheral nervous system related to the central nervous system?
○ it communicates between the central nervous system and the muscles and organs.
○ it is one of two main neural systems that make up the central nervous system.
○ it carries messages between the left and right hemispheres of the cerebrum.

Explanation:

Brief Explanations
  • Analyze Option 1: The peripheral nervous system (PNS) consists of nerves that connect the central nervous system (CNS, brain and spinal cord) to the rest of the body (muscles, organs, etc.), transmitting signals between them. This matches the function of PNS.
  • Analyze Option 2: The PNS is separate from the CNS; the CNS is made of the brain and spinal cord, while PNS is the other part of the nervous system (not part of CNS). So this is incorrect.
  • Analyze Option 3: The corpus callosum carries messages between the two hemispheres of the cerebrum, not the PNS. So this is incorrect.

Answer:

A. It communicates between the central nervous system and the muscles and organs.
